Give your subscribers information they can use and they'll give you their attention, and ultimately their business. Key 02 -> Send Promotional Mailings Regularly. One of the most shocking discoveries that I ever made in my work with email marketing is this: **If you don't send promotional mailings regularly, your response rates will go down dramatically.** Trust me. I've tested it. So have a lot of other people. Now, don't get me wrong, I'm not talking about sending out solo mailings five times a day. That's a shortcut to failure there. But, at the same time, sending out promotional mailings at a very infrequent, sporadic pace is a shortcut to failure as well. Either way, you ain't gettin' paid. They key is balance. As a very "general" rule of thumb, one promotional mailing (I.E. "solo mailing") per week seems to produce the best results. Test for yourself. Your list may be different. Regardless of the frequency you decide upon,it absolutely needs to be REGULAR. Consistency in regularity. Key 03 -> Verify Your Subscribers Are Receiving Your Mailings. Without question, this is the most often overlooked key to email profits of them all. There is no substitute for this one. If your list members aren't receiving your email messages... stick a fork in yourself, because "you're done." You can have great content and send out those solo mailings like clockwork, but if no one on the other end of the line is getting them, it's a waste of your time.
